MATTER OF VERMILYE


101 A.D.2d 865 (1984)

In the Matter of The Estate of Alice C. Vermilye, Deceased. George McCormack, Appellant; Public Administrator of Kings County et al., Respondents

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Second Department.

May 21, 1984


¶ Order reversed, on the law and in the exercise of discretion, with costs payable out of the estate, application denied, and cross motion granted.
